Backflow plumbing replacement services involve removing and installing new backflow preventers to ensure the safety and integrity of a property's water supply. These services typically include inspecting existing backflow devices, removing outdated or damaged units, and installing new, compliant preventers that meet local plumbing codes. The process is designed to pr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the main water supply, protecting the health of residents and the quality of the water system.
This service addresses common issues such as device failure, corrosion, or damage caused by age, weather, or improper installation. A malfunctioning backflow preventer can lead to water contamination, which poses health risks and can result in costly repairs or water quality violations. Regular replacement of backflow preventers can help avoid these problems by ensuring that the devices are functioning correctly and meet current safety standards.

Cost Range - Backflow plumbing replacement services typically cost between $1,200 and $3,500, depending on the system size and complexity. For example, replacing a standard backflow preventer may be closer to $1,200, while larger commercial systems can reach higher costs.
Factors Influencing Cost - The total expense can vary based on the type of backflow preventer, accessibility, and local labor rates. Additional fees may apply for permits or system modifications, impacting the overall price.
Average Service Fees - On average, homeowners in Glendale, AZ, might pay around $1,500 to $2,500 for a professional backflow plumbing replacement. Costs can fluctuate based on specific system requirements and contractor rates in the area.
